To create a rural house that draws its inspiration from Australian station buildings with a New Zealand twist. Outdoor living was identified as a major design focus, with relaxed and open family living.

Mary Jowett Architects Response

The response to the site lead to an open gable face for the living areas, opening onto screened outdoor living areas, treated like rooms. The sleeping zones are separated in plan and form, closing down to more intimate spaces. The western red weatherboard cladding was chosen as a stable and versatile building material, with the black post and beam accents.
